The Effect of Geometry Flashcard Learning Media on Elementary School Students’ Ability to Understand Basic Concepts of Solid Figures

This study aims to examine the effect of geometry flashcard learning media on elementary school students' understanding of basic three-dimensional geometry concepts at MIS Nurul Aflah. The study employed a quantitative approach using a quasi-experimental method with a Pretest–Posttest Control Group Design. The sample consisted of 30 third-grade students, divided into 15 students in the experimental group and 15 students in the control group, selected through purposive sampling. The research instruments included five essay test items that met the validity and reliability requirements, supported by observation sheets and documentation. The findings revealed that the experimental group's mean pretest score increased from 57.33 to 84.27 on the posttest, while the control group's mean score improved from 56.67 to 71.20. The normality test yielded significance values of 0.200, and 0.176, while the homogeneity test produced a significance value of 0.482, indicating that the data were normally distributed and homogeneous. Furthermore, the Independent Samples t-test resulted in a significance value of 0.001 (<0.05), indicating that the use of geometry flashcard learning media had a significant positive effect on students' understanding of basic three-dimensional geometry concepts..
